1.24 Troubleshoot Technology Problems. Describe at least three perplexing technology problems for technology coordinators and the process you used or would use to solve them.

Introduction

Stuff Happens ALL the time! Some problems are easily fixed, while others are more complex. What types of problems occur in schools that are perplexing? How do you as a Technology Coordinator set out to address and solve complex issues?
